Capital Fund Management (CFM)'s Q1 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2016, Capital Fund Management (CFM) held 2,091 positions worth $10.3B, up 5.9% from $9.72B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 10% of the portfolio.

Capital Fund Management (CFM) deployed $513M of net new capital in Q1 2016, opening 587 new positions and adding to 453 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was American Express: 1,791,450 shares worth $110M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 8.7% of assets, down from 9.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Nike, an estimated $111M trimmed.
